The Ultimate Guide to Outdoor Fishing Storage: Keeping Your Gear Organized and Protected24
As an outdoor enthusiast, you know that having the right gear is essential for a successful fishing trip. But what's just as important as having the right gear is having a system for keeping it organized and protected. That's where outdoor fishing storage comes in.
There are a variety of different types of outdoor fishing storage available, from tackle boxes to backpacks to coolers. The best type of storage for you will depend on the type of fishing you do, the amount of gear you need to carry, and your budget. But no matter what type of storage you choose, there are a few key things to keep in mind.
Durability
Your outdoor fishing storage needs to be able to withstand the elements. It should be made of durable materials that can stand up to rain, snow, and sun. It should also be able to resist tearing and abrasion.
Organization
Your storage should be organized in a way that makes it easy to find what you need, when you need it. Look for storage with multiple compartments and pockets, so you can keep your gear separated and tidy.
Convenience
Your storage should be easy to carry and transport. If you're going to be hiking to your fishing spot, you'll want something that's lightweight and comfortable to carry. If you're going to be fishing from a boat, you'll need something that's waterproof and can withstand being splashed.
Here are some tips for organizing your outdoor fishing storage:
Use a tackle box to store your lures, hooks, and other small items.
Use a backpack to carry your larger items, such as your rod and reel, extra line, and snacks.
Use a cooler to keep your food and drinks cold.
Use a waterproof bag to protect your electronics and other valuables.
Label your storage containers so you know what's inside each one.
Keep your storage clean and organized so you can find what you need quickly and easily.
Conclusion
By following these tips, you can keep your fishing gear organized and protected, so you can focus on enjoying your time on the water.
